This is a Commodore 64 demo "Das Boot" from Lethargy, released at the X 2024 held in Netherlands. It participated the Demo compo and was third.
Credits:
Code by Sei, Loloke and Visage
Graphics by Grass
Music by Vincenzo
More information about this production is available at Demozoo:
demozoo.org/productions/345898/
This video has been recorded with a genuine Commodore 64 with a SID 8580.
